Kinnerley St. Mary Service Times
Sunday
Holy Communion
A 'central' Anglican Holy Communion Service using Common Worship, followed by tea or coffee at the back of the church. We especially encourage newcomers and visitors and do our best to make everyone feel welcome, something that we in Kinnerley think we are very good at.
Every first second and third Sunday at 9:45 AM for 1 hour
Worship for All
An informal non Eucharistic service
Every third Sunday at 9:45 AM for 1 hour
Combined Service for all Five Churches
This Holy Communion service is held at one of the churches in the Benefice. Link to the Kinnerley Parish web site for details of location.
Every fifth Sunday at 10:00 AM for 1 hour
Monday
SupaClub
This is our alternative to Junior Church for the younger children. They meet at Knockin Assembly Rooms during term time.
Every Monday at 4:30 PM for 1 hour
Thursday
Mothers' Union
Mothers' Union meet in the Parish Hall and also lead the Mothering Sunday service.
Every first Thursday at 2:00 PM for 2 hours
Friday
Youth Club
For the older children. They meet in term time at Knockin Assembly Rooms.
Every Friday at 7:30 PM for 2 hours
Saturday
Tea, coffee and home-made scones
A very popular event, with many visitors. Drop-in for an informal and very friendly get together with some of the locals. Free refreshments.
Every Saturday at 10:30 AM for 1½ hours
